As you know, preliminary estimates show that global gas demand has declined by 65 billion cubic meters in 2022. It should also be pointed out that 55 out of 65 billion cubic meters in this reduction figure are attributable to the decrease in gas demand in the 27 EU countries. This fact is very telling.
Gazprom's total gas production for 2022 will amount to 412.6 billion cubic meters. This amount of gas will be quite enough for us to fulfill all of our obligations to our domestic consumers, as well as to perform the required export supplies. Gazprom will supply 243.1 billion cubic meters of gas to Russian consumers from the Company's gas transmission system. Gazprom's gas exports to the countries beyond the FSU will amount to 100.9 billion cubic meters.

There is no doubt that it is a key task for Gazprom to ensure reliable gas supplies during the autumn/winter peak. During the preparations for winter, we are breaking new records every year. And 2022 is no exception. The working gas inventories created [in Russia's underground storage facilities] by the start of the withdrawal period totaled 72,662 million cubic meters of gas. And the daily deliverability as of the start of the withdrawal period stood at 852.4 million cubic meters. These are our new records.

In this connection, I would like to mention the Yamal gas production center, of course. Yamal's backbone field is the Bovanenkovskoye field. This year, we commenced the development of the deeper-lying Neocomian-Jurassic deposits. In Yamal, we are also developing the Kharasaveyskoye field, which is the second most important field within this gas production center.
And it is imperative to note that our fields will produce gas for many years into the future. At some fields, production will stop in 2141 or maybe even later.
We have been setting a record for 18 consecutive years: our reserve replacement ratio consistently exceeds 1. We carry out extensive work to develop the Company's resource base in eastern Russia. Last week saw an important milestone. In the presence of Vladimir Putin, President of the Russian Federation, Gazprom launched the new Irkutsk gas production center.
We put onstream the Kovyktinskoye field and the new linear section of the Power of Siberia gas pipeline between the Kovyktinskoye and Chayandinskoye fields. The entire length of Power of Siberia – more than 3,000 kilometers – is in operation now. Just get this: it is the world's largest engineering-and-production infrastructure complex which comprises production, transmission and processing facilities. There are no other engineering-and-production complexes of this size in the world. Our complex is the largest one in terms of scale.
We are well aware that gas obtained from the Kovyktinskoye and Chayandinskoye fields contains valuable components. In this regard, I would like to put an emphasis on helium. Gas from the Kovyktinskoye field goes to the Chayandinskoye field, and then the gas flows of Kovyktinskoye and Chayandinskoye are mixed together and reach the Amur Region, where the Amur Gas Processing Plant is currently under construction. Despite any difficulties and obstacles our “opponents” are trying to create for us, the Amur Gas Processing Plant construction project is 87.86 per cent complete today. And most importantly, we completely fulfill our tasks in terms of providing gas supplies to the People's Republic of China under the thirty-year contract. And we do so without any delays.

But it is equally important that we are creating the capacities required to export large amounts of gas to the Chinese market – the world's most dynamic and the fastest-growing one.
For instance, we have mentioned that global gas consumption is expected to increase by 20 per cent over the next 20 years. And the same forecast predicts that the growth in China's gas consumption over the next 20 years will make up 40 per cent of the total global growth. Without any doubt, we are paying our utmost and undivided attention to staying in compliance with all of the contractual obligations we have assumed under the thirty-year contract, and are working to exceed the existing commitments.
Gazprom has decided that in December 2022 it will supply gas to China in excess of the Company's daily contractual obligations. The maximum excess above the contractual amounts was 18.7 per cent. Today, Gazprom will set another new daily record for exports of Russian gas to China.
Therefore, we continue our efforts in terms of the work with China. It should be noted that this year we have signed the contract with regard to the Far Eastern route, which makes it possible for us to deliver 10 billion cubic meters of gas from the Russian Far East. In the very near future, our overall annual gas exports to China will total 48 billion cubic meters. And if we take into account the transit export gas pipeline stretching across Mongolia, this amount will total nearly 100 billion cubic meters, with the current design capacity of the transit gas pipeline across Mongolia amounting to 50 billion cubic meters per year.

Gas infrastructure expansion is, for sure, a highly important and socially significant project. We can say that it is almost finished. Why? Because in ten years all regions of our country will have a 100 per cent technically possible access to gas grid. At the same time, pursuant to the instruction of Russian President Vladimir Putin, Gazprom also started an additional social gas grid expansion program. It covers the households situated in those localities which already have access to network gas, but their houses are still not connected to gas for some reason.
I would like to say that for the second year in a row we perform the gas expansion program ahead of schedule. The overall length of inter-settlement gas pipelines built within this year will exceed 3,000 kilometers. Of course, gas infrastructure expansion mainly concerns rural areas.
